Eliminating Entry Bottlenecks Through Smart QR Verification
Concert organizers have finally solved one of the industry's most persistent headaches: the dreaded entry queue. Traditional paper tickets and even basic digital tickets created massive bottlenecks at venue entrances, with some festivals experiencing wait times exceeding two hours.
Modern QR concert systems utilize multi-layered verification that processes attendees in seconds rather than minutes. Each ticket contains encrypted data that includes:
Unique attendee identification
Seat or zone assignment
Purchase verification timestamp
Anti-counterfeiting digital signatures
The scanning infrastructure has evolved beyond simple barcode readers. High-speed QR scanners can now process up to 15 tickets simultaneously, while mobile scanning units allow staff to verify tickets anywhere on the venue perimeter. This distributed approach prevents single-point bottlenecks and maintains smooth crowd flow even during peak arrival times.
Stadium-sized venues report 85% reduction in average entry times since implementing advanced contactless ticketing systems. The Mercedes-Benz Stadium in Atlanta processes 70,000 NFL fans in under 30 minutes using strategically placed QR verification points throughout the facility.
Dynamic Fraud Prevention and Anti-Scalping Measures
Ticket fraud prevention has grown increasingly sophisticated as counterfeiters attempt to exploit high-demand shows. Dynamic QR verification systems now generate new codes every 30 seconds, making screenshot-based fraud virtually impossible.
The technology works through time-sensitive encryption that validates tickets only within specific windows. When an attendee approaches the venue, their mobile app automatically refreshes the QR code with current authentication data. This happens seamlessly in the background, requiring no user intervention while providing robust security.
Anti-scalping measures have proven equally effective. Each QR code is cryptographically linked to the original purchaser's identity, payment method, and mobile device. Secondary market transfers require explicit authorization through the official platform, creating a transparent chain of ownership that eliminates unauthorized resales.
Major touring artists report 95% reduction in fraudulent ticket incidents since adopting dynamic QR systems. Taylor Swift's Eras Tour, which faced massive scalping attempts, successfully blocked over 2 million counterfeit tickets through real-time QR verification.
Real-Time Crowd Management and Safety Analytics
Music event management has been transformed by QR-enabled crowd tracking capabilities. Every ticket scan provides precise location and timestamp data, allowing organizers to monitor crowd density in real-time across different venue zones.
Advanced analytics platforms like QRlytics process this data to identify potential safety concerns before they escalate. Heat maps show crowd concentration levels, while predictive algorithms forecast movement patterns based on historical data and current conditions.
Emergency response protocols now integrate directly with QR tracking systems. If evacuation becomes necessary, organizers can instantly identify which zones require priority attention and track evacuation progress in real-time. This capability proved crucial during recent severe weather events at outdoor festivals.
The system also enables proactive crowd redistribution. When sensors detect overcrowding in specific areas, digital signage and mobile notifications guide attendees toward less congested zones. Food vendors and merchandise stands receive real-time updates about nearby crowd density, allowing them to adjust staffing accordingly.
Enhanced Marketing Through Interactive QR Campaigns
Festival QR codes have transformed pre-event marketing strategies. Billboard and poster campaigns now feature interactive QR codes that provide immersive experiences beyond simple ticket purchasing.
Scanning a promotional QR code might unlock:
Exclusive behind-the-scenes content
Artist interviews and performance previews
Limited-time discount codes
Social media contest entries
Virtual venue tours
These fan engagement tools generate valuable data about potential attendees' preferences and behavior patterns. Organizers use this information to optimize lineup announcements, merchandise offerings, and venue layout decisions.
Location-based QR campaigns have proven particularly effective. Codes placed in music venues, record stores, and college campuses provide geographically targeted messaging. A QR code in Nashville might promote country music festivals, while one in Brooklyn focuses on indie rock events.
The data collected through these campaigns helps organizers understand their audience demographics and adjust marketing spend accordingly. Real-time analytics show which promotional channels drive the highest-quality ticket sales and longest attendee engagement.
Seamless Mobile Wallet Integration
The integration of QR tickets with mobile wallet systems has created unprecedented convenience for concert attendees. Apple Wallet, Google Pay, and Samsung Pay now support advanced QR ticketing features that work even without internet connectivity.
Mobile wallet integration provides several key advantages:
Offline functionality ensures tickets work regardless of network congestion
Automatic updates push important venue information and schedule changes
Location-based notifications provide parking and transportation guidance
Post-event features enable easy photo sharing and merchandise reordering
The technology extends beyond basic ticket storage. Integrated payment systems allow attendees to purchase concessions, merchandise, and parking using the same QR-enabled mobile wallet. This creates a completely cashless experience that reduces transaction times and improves vendor efficiency—similar to how QR codes are transforming restaurant service with contactless payments and digital menus.
Crowd control technology benefits significantly from wallet integration. Venue staff can instantly verify ticket authenticity, check vaccination status where required, and access emergency contact information if needed. This comprehensive data access improves both security and customer service capabilities.
Advanced Analytics and Performance Optimization
Real-time analytics have transformed how organizers measure success and plan future events. QR scanning data provides detailed insights into attendee behavior, from arrival patterns to concession purchasing habits.
Key metrics now tracked include:
Peak arrival and departure times by entrance
Average time spent in different venue areas
Concession and merchandise sales by location
Re-entry patterns and frequency
Emergency exit usage during evacuations
This data enables continuous optimization throughout multi-day festivals. If analytics show overcrowding at specific food vendors, organizers can deploy additional mobile units to reduce wait times. Stage scheduling adjustments can redistribute crowds more evenly across the venue.
Post-event analysis helps improve future planning. Historical QR data reveals optimal entrance configurations, staffing requirements, and vendor placement strategies. Organizers can predict attendance patterns for similar events and adjust logistics accordingly. Future Innovations and Industry Trends
The evolution of QR concert systems continues accelerating with emerging technologies. Augmented reality integration allows attendees to scan codes for immersive venue navigation and artist information overlays. Blockchain verification adds additional security layers while enabling secure secondary market transactions.
Artificial intelligence algorithms now predict optimal QR code placement for maximum scan rates and engagement. Machine learning models analyze scanning patterns to identify potential fraud attempts before they succeed.
Environmental sustainability has become another focus area. Digital QR tickets eliminate millions of paper tickets annually, while real-time crowd analytics optimize transportation and reduce venue waste—much like the reduction in printing costs and waste seen in restaurants that have adopted digital QR menus.
